This is my first time WCing a computer. I would like your input on if this set up would work.
I am going to use: RBX, maze 4 for the chipset, NV-78, a dual 120mm radiator and a dual 80mm radiator.
This is how i plan to place them

plan.jpg


and i was think of separating the cpu loop and the chipset/gpu loop. The cpu would use the dual 120 radiator and the chipset and gpu would use the dual 80mm radiator.
Thanks.
 
If you bother using two radiators, make seperate loops. I could be wrong on this, but I think a CPU/chipset/7800 setup should be just fine with a dual 120 radiator. However, by the looks of your system it seems like you have extra money to spend so I would say go ahead with the dual loop system. The graphics card puts out enough heat that I might have it use the dual 80 radiator and then put the CPU and chipset on the dual 120. Finally, don't fight the natural flow of air. Don't bring in air from the top and shoot it out the bottom, bring it in the cooler bottom and put it out the top where hot air will collect.

Lastly I would like to know which radaitor is better the Black Ice Xtreme 2 or the Black Ice Xtreme 2 X-Flow.
Thanks a bunch :)
 
I am not sure what to say in those regards. The HWlabs web site rates them both for the same energy output (both the same KCals of heat per hour) but the XFlow is a little bit thicker and longer so it might make sense that it would perform better. The XFlow I guess has larger pipes for the water but I have no idea since the very company doesn't even change the heat output ratings :confused: :confused: :confused:
 
That is weird, the only difference is that the X-flow is a single-pass and the Xtreme II is a double-pass. I am guessing that since the Xtreme II has more resistance and flow would be slower but in turn cooling the water even more, and even more since the water will travel double the distance of the X-Flow.
